On August 12th, AMBER Alert Europe was consulted by the Federal Police in Switzerland. The meeting brought together specialist from the Federal Police, SIRENE and the Federal Office of Justice in the field of missing children.

Aim of the meeting was to exchange good practices to improve the better protection of missing children. AMBER Alert Europe was represented by President Frank Hoen and European Alert Coordinator and law enforcement missing persons specialist Charlie Hedges.

AMBER Alert Europe is actively working with countries on improving the protection of missing children following its 5-point plan. These 5 recommendations to save missing children are also supported by a great majority of 465 Members of European Parliament, representing all European Member States and political parties.
